Sales of the all-new 2003 Saab 9-3 Sport Sedan off to a strong start
Norcross, GA - Saab Cars USA reported sales of 1,023 all-new 9-3 Sport Sedans for November, the first full month of sales for the Swedish automaker's newest model. This volume more than doubles the quantity of old 9-3 hardtops, three- and five-door hatchbacks combined, retailed in November 2001.
"The new Sport Sedan is reinvigorating Saab in the marketplace," said Richard O'Kelley, Vice President of Sales for Saab Cars USA. Ê"We're seeing more dealer traffic, more test drives, higher consideration, and increased overall brand awareness.
"The transition from hatchback to sedan has broadened the target audience for the Saab 9-3. ÊThroughout the launch of the new 9-3 Sport Sedan we've said that we expect to double our 9-3 hardtop sales volume and we're already beginning to do that."
For total November sales, Saab Cars USA retailed 2,772 units, a 6.5 percent increase over last November.
